SUMMARY

The authors present a review of the literature concerning the specifics of the hospitalization of AIDS patients in Intensive Care Units (ICU) in an attempt to contribute towards giving answers to questions frequently posed by these patients; namely ICU admission, reanimation and the suspending of therapy.
